Интернет-магазин VaM Shop => Установка и настройка => Тема начата: Blacklabel от 18 Декабря 2007, 12:09:52
Название: как устанавливать НОВУЮ версию?
Отправлено: Blacklabel от 18 Декабря 2007, 12:09:52
сейчас стоит версия 1,31 скачал в своих заках версию 1,37
возник вопрос - как ПРАВИЛЬНО все заменить и установить чтоб не полетела имеющаяся база... Про шаблон не спрашиваю - стоит один из дефолтных... но на будущее так же интересно.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 18 Декабря 2007, 12:11:38
Что б сохранить все свои данные, нужно обновлять патчами. т.е. ставить все патчи начиная с следующего за твоей версий, без перескоков.
Но лучше на работающем магазине сразу не ставь. Лучше сначала на локальном компе попробуй, что б всё нормально прошло и магазин не сломался.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: Blacklabel от 18 Декабря 2007, 12:19:12
нет у меня "локального компа". Не настолько я силен в установке сервера SQL, апачей, PHP и т.п. Есть хостинг в инете - там стоит и работает магазин. а патчами поднимать версию этож долго и СЛИШКОМ много этапов - где-то да и возникнет ошибка. Может быть следует предусмотреть возможность замены пропатченных файлов, выполнение необходимого запроса к базе SQL и т.п. для таких как Я - т.е. не следящих постоянно за обновлениями (ну нет времени, к сожалению) и именно по причине "нет времени" выполнение ОДНОГО патча для установки последней версии ?!?!?
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 18 Декабря 2007, 12:32:24
К сожалению, так не получится, легко и просто, лучше тогда работать на той версии, что есть, патчи сразу накатывать на рабочий магазин не советую, есть вероятность при неправильных действиях сломать магазин.
С 1.31 довольно много вмего поменялось, процентов 90% файлов было изменено.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 18 Декабря 2007, 12:34:00
Всё-таки если есть желание обновиться и есть время, нужно установить денвер на локальный комп. Вот тут я писал как ставить денвер - http://oscommerce.su/manual/ch03s02.phpl
Если нет времени совсем, лучше пусть работает на 1.31
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: Blacklabel от 18 Декабря 2007, 12:49:25
Хорошо. Спасибо.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: Blacklabel от 18 Декабря 2007, 13:06:40
все же рискну "поднять версию". скачал первый патч. возникли вопросы в ридми сказано: "Загрузите в базу данных своего магазина SQL файл из папки sql (если нет файла внутри папки sql, пропустите данный шаг)" имеется ввыиду выполнить запрос что написан в текстовом файле через MyPHP ? просто не могу представить как файл добавить в базу SQL Таблицу добавить (создать) - понимаю. добавить в таблице строки тоже понятно. но как ФАЙЛ загрузить в SQL ??
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 18 Декабря 2007, 17:44:00
Да, через phpMyAdmin выполнить файл этот. Зайти в phpMyAdmin в закладку SQL или в закладку Импорт.
Но ещё раз предостерегаю, очень аккуратно с патчами. Сделайте резервную копию всех файлах и базы данных, что б если что случится, можно было откатиться на рабочую версию.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: AlexandrP от 11 Января 2008, 21:38:01
Добавлю свои 5копеек... т.к. обжегся с патчиньем :)
Безболезненно проходят только патчи до 1.34 (включительно) Затем (с 1.35) происходит смена кодировки на utf8, что (как указано в редми) нужно делать только если очень хочется, т.к. если нет определенного опыта и времени+желания - можно запросто убить всё. Хорошо, если это на компе, а если на хосте? ;) Думаю об этом тут уже много напИсано...
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 12 Января 2008, 10:32:56
Я просто предупреждаю, что если не уверены, лучше не ставить экперименты на работающем магазине. Закачай магазин к себе на локальный комп и попробуй сначала на локальном компе.
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: Blacklabel от 14 Января 2008, 10:50:53
К сожалению у меня нет "локального компа". Но есть желание сделав все ЧЕТКО по инструкции не попасть в просак...
Название: Re: как устанавливать НОВУЮ версию?
Отправлено: VaM от 14 Января 2008, 10:56:13
Тогда сделаю на сервере копию магазина, т.е. поставь основной магазин в папку shop например. Скопируй все файлы в папку shop, сделай новую базу данных, загрузи туда свою работающую базу, т.е. сделй базу данных для экспериментов, что б не поломать работающий магазин.
Затем, скопировав файлы в shop и сделав новую базу, отредактируй конфиги в папке shop. /shop/includes/configure.php /shop/admin/includes/configure.php
Укажи там пути до директории shop и внизу доступ к базе новой.
и уже пробуй на этой копии реального магазина обновиться, если будет всё нормально, можно будет и работающий магазин обновить.